BMS Digital Safety: Risks, Mitigation, and Future Trends

The increasing adoption of Building Management Systems (BMS) through digital management introduces significant safety vulnerabilities. These might include unauthorized intrusion , cyber compromises, and viruses that could impair critical building services, leading to likely safety events . Mitigation approaches involve a layered security system, encompassing secure authentication, network segmentation , regular penetration testing, and timely patch deployment read more . Looking forward the future , trends such as distributed copyright technologies, artificial intelligence -driven threat detection , and least-privilege security models are expected to further BMS digital safety and robustness .

Digital Safety in BMS: Addressing Vulnerabilities and Implementing Controls

Ensuring robust Building Management Systems (BMS) demands a proactive method to digital protection. The increasing connectivity of BMS to the cloud introduces considerable vulnerabilities, including possible unauthorized entry and data compromises . Addressing these dangers necessitates a layered defense , involving frequent vulnerability scans , diligent patch management , and the use of stringent safeguards such as network segmentation , strong authentication systems, and thorough access recording. Moreover, staff training and understanding programs are vital to mitigate human error, a frequent source of safety incidents.
